New Foremast For Ernestina
Posted on August 4, 2011 by Schooner Ernestina-Morrissey Association
SEMA has ordered a new foremast for Ernestina. The mast will be shaped at The Spar Shop, part of Grays Harbor Historical Seaport. Watch the fantastic video: Spar Shop Tracer-Lathe showing their tracer-lathe, the largest in North America. … Continue reading →

USCG Barque Eagle Presentation in New Bedford
Posted on August 4, 2011 by Schooner Ernestina-Morrissey Association
This summer the USCG Cutter Eagle traveled north of the Arctic Circle on the voyage from Europe to Boston. The Eagle sailed in waters off Iceland familiar to Capt. “Bob” Bartlett and his “Little Morrissey” now Ernestina. Read Don Cuddy’s … Continue reading →

Ernestina Archives Safeguarded
Posted on August 3, 2011 by Schooner Ernestina-Morrissey Association
Valuable items from the Ernestina Commission Archives have been transferred to the Archives and Special Collections at the University of Massachusetts| Dartmouth. Watch for the announcement of the formal transfer in September. Ernestina Life ring from São Vicente,(Cape Verde)
